A thesis submitted in partial fulfillment of the requirements for the degree of Master of Science, School of Environment, Resources & Development
Thesis (M.Sc.) - Asian Institute of Technology, 1984
A survey was conducted to investigate the microbial quality of UHT products in order to find out possible cause of defects and to draw up recommendations for quality improvement. It was carried out in close collaboration with selected milk plants in Thailand and Indonesia using the sampling procedures prescribed by the military standard 105D and the recommendations of Tetra Pak and dairy firms. The results of the laboratory test on the unsterile samples revealed the presence of organisms and flora species which were found through thermoresistance test, pH of PCA test ,gram stain, morphological analyses and catalase test, that some of the organisms are either thermoresistant or non-thermoresistant types. In addition to these, various mixed-flora species were identified. It was found that there is a high probability of contamination during the packaging processes, i.e., changing of strips, changing roll of paper, starting of production, and thus, proper disinfection and control measures should be observed during packaging. In doing so, the presence of non-thermoresistant bacteria due to further contamination during handling operations can also be minimized.
